In order to make decisions on the management of scientific projects, specialists need to obtain data slices from various sources related to one or more scientific projects in a short time. Structured repositories for this data are under development: storage structures and data processing methods are being upgraded and supplemented. It is necessary to develop the architecture and layout of a system that provides comprehensive processing of information on the progress of scientific projects.
Structure the storage and automate the processing of incoming and stored documentation in order to optimize the process of planning and monitoring scientific projects and support management decisions. The entire cycle of document processing and analysis should be integrated into a single system called the ISU NCFM. The system should enable interaction between existing modules and subsystems and should ensure scalability and sustainability. An architecture has been proposed and a functional mock-up of the NCFM information management system has been created, automating a number of tasks for processing and analyzing documentation. The layout is undergoing user testing, work is underway to improve the quality of completed tasks and develop modules that expand functionality.
The developed layout of the ISU NCFM is deployed on the basis of the RFNC NCFM, used in the processing of incoming documentation and its analysis. The parsing module is used both in conjunction with the intelligent processing platform and separately to extract information from documents, and is registered as a software product.
